What Does Joshua 8:11 Mean?

The visible force takes its position openly on Ai's north side, in plain sight of the defenders, with a valley between. This is the bait of the plan: an army the king of Ai can see and be tempted to attack, while the real threat lies hidden to the west.

What the eye sees is rarely the whole of what God is doing. Ai looked across the valley and saw only the army before them, never the ambush behind. So often the Lord works most decisively in what is unseen. We are called to trust that there is more to His purposes than the portion visible to us, that behind the apparent situation He has positioned what no enemy can perceive.
